Hardscaping Service in Norwalk, CT
H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and enhancement of durable outdoor features that improve the functionality and aesthetic appeal of residential properties. Typical projects include constructing patios, walkways, retaining walls, driveways, and outdoor living spaces such as fire pits or seating areas. Property owners often seek these services to create well-defined outdoor areas that increase curb appeal, provide additional entertainment spaces, or improve drainage and landscape stability. Before requesting hardscaping work, homeowners should consider the intended use of the area, preferred materials, and any necessary permits or property restrictions that might influence the scope of the project.
Understanding the scope of a hardscaping project involves knowing the types of materials available, such as pavers, concrete, stone, or brick, and how they suit specific outdoor needs. It is also beneficial to consider the existing landscape and how new features will integrate with or alter it. Homeowners typically want clarity on the durability and maintenance requirements of different materials, as well as an idea of how the project will impact their outdoor space in terms of aesthetics and functionality. Proper planning ensures that the final result aligns with the property's style and the homeowner’s practical needs.

Hardscaping Service Questions
What is hardscaping? Hardscaping involves the installation of non-living elements like pat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or features to enhance a property's functionality and appearance.
What types of projects are common with hardscaping services? Typical projects include creating patios, installing walkways, building retaining walls, and designing outdoor living spaces.
How can hardscaping improve a property? Hardscaping adds structure, increases outdoor usability, improves curb appeal, and can help with drainage and erosion control.
What materials are used in hardscaping? Common materials include concrete, brick, stone, pavers, and natural flagstone,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
